Overview
This detailed journey outlines every step a customer experiences when using the AI-driven transport management system. It includes all communications, AI applications, and third-party integrations, ensuring a seamless end-to-end process from the initial request to the completion of the delivery.
1. Customer Searches for Transport Services
- Action:some text
- The customer needs to transport a load (e.g., moving furniture, shipping a motorcycle).
- Decision Point:some text
- Chooses to use the AI-driven transport service provided by ADXL.
2. Customer Initiates Contact with AI
- Communication Options:some text
- Phone Call: Dials the service number.
- SMS/Text Message: Sends a text to the service number.
- Email: Sends an email detailing the request.
- Online Chat: Initiates a chat on the website or mobile app.
- AI Response:some text
- Phone Call: AI answers with a human-like voice using Natural Language Processing (NLP) and Text-to-Speech (TTS) technologies.
- SMS/Email/Chat: AI responds promptly, acknowledging the contact and ready to assist.
3. AI Gathers Initial Information
- AI Prompts:some text
- Greets the customer by name if known or asks for it.
- Requests contact information (phone number, email address).
- Asks for details about the transport need:some text
- Type of Load: Furniture, vehicle, equipment, etc.
- Description: Size, weight, quantity.
- Pickup Location: Address verification using Google Maps API.
- Delivery Location: Address verification.
- Preferred Dates and Times: For pickup and delivery.
- Special Requirements: Fragile items, need for special equipment.
- Customer Actions:some text
- Provides the requested information verbally or via text, depending on the communication method.
- AI Applications:some text
- Speech Recognition: Converts spoken words to text.
- Data Validation: Checks for completeness and correctness.
4. AI Requests Photos for Load Assessment
- AI Instructions:some text
- Explains the benefit of providing photos for accurate assessment.
- Guides the customer on how to send photos:some text
- SMS/MMS: Send a link to upload photos.
- Email: Requests attachments.
- Chat/App: Provides an upload button.
- Customer Actions:some text
- Take photos of the load and access points.
- Uploads or sends photos as per instructions.
- AI Applications:some text
- Computer Vision Module: Prepares to analyze incoming images.
5. AI Analyzes Photos and Information
- Processing:some text
- Image Analysis:some text
- Determines dimensions of the load.
- Assesses site access (driveway width, obstacles).
- Data Cross-Verification:some text
- Confirms details match the provided descriptions.
- Risk Assessment:some text
- Identifies any special handling requirements.
- Image Analysis:some text
- Third-Party Integrations:some text
- Mapping Services: Evaluates route feasibility.
- Weather Data APIs: Checks for any weather-related concerns.
6. AI Determines Optimal Vehicle and Transport Options
- Data Retrieval:some text
- Accesses the database of pre-registered vehicles and drivers.
- Matching Process:some text
- Filters vehicles based on:some text
- Capacity: Size and weight limits.
- Availability: Work hours and current location using GPS Tracking.
- Driver Preferences: Type of cargo transported in the past.
- Regulatory Compliance: Ensures driver's licenses and vehicle inspections are up-to-date.
- Filters vehicles based on:some text
- AI Applications:some text
- Vector-Based Storage: Retrieves driver and vehicle profiles.
- Predictive Analytics: Estimates travel times and potential delays.
7. AI Calculates Pricing
- Scenario A: Pre-Configured Pricing Existssome text
- Process:some text
- Applies the transport company's pricing structure.
- Calculates the quote based on distance, load specifics, and any additional services (e.g., insurance).
- Process:some text
- Scenario B: No Pre-Configured Pricingsome text
- Process:some text
- Contact potential drivers to request a custom quote.
- Process:some text
- Communication with Drivers:some text
- Sends job details via:some text
- Email/SMS: Contains load details and a request for pricing.
- Voice Call (if driving): AI initiates a hands-free call.
- Sends job details via:some text
- Driver Responses:some text
- Accepts Pre-Calculated Price: Confirms availability.
- Proposes New Price: States the new rate verbally or via text.
- Asks Questions: Seeks additional information before quoting.
- Declines: Indicates unavailability.
- AI Applications:some text
- Automated Negotiation Module: Handles price adjustments.
- Voice Recognition: Captures driver's verbal responses.
8. AI Presents Transport Options to Customer
- Communication:some text
- Provides a detailed proposal including:some text
- Vehicle Details: Type, size, capacity.
- Driver Information: Experience, ratings, compliance status.
- Pricing: Total cost, breakdown of charges.
- Additional Services: Insurance options, estimated delivery time.
- Provides a detailed proposal including:some text
- Customer Actions:some text
- Review the proposal.
- May ask follow-up questions or request modifications.
- AI Applications:some text
- Interactive Communication: Engages in real-time Q&A.
- Dynamic Proposal Generation: Updates quotes as per customer input.
9. Customer Confirms Booking
- Action:some text
- Accepts the proposal and agrees to proceed.
- AI Response:some text
- Acknowledges acceptance.
- Summarizes the agreement details for confirmation.
- Communication:some text
- Send a summary via email or text for records.
10. AI Initiates Payment Process
- Payment Request:some text
- Generates an invoice outlining:some text
- Service Details: Load, distance, services.
- Total Amount Due: Including any taxes or fees.
- Sends a secure payment link.
- Generates an invoice outlining:some text
- Customer Actions:some text
- Clicks the payment link.
- Chooses a payment method (credit card, digital wallet).
- Completes the transaction.
- Third-Party Integrations:some text
- Payment Gateway (e.g., Stripe, PayPal): Processes the payment securely.
- Escrow Service: Holds funds until delivery confirmation.
- AI Applications:some text
- Payment Verification: Confirms receipt of funds.
- Security Protocols: Ensures data encryption and compliance with financial regulations.
11. AI Confirms Booking with Driver
- Communication with Driver:some text
- Notifies the driver of confirmed booking via:some text
- Voice Call: If the driver is on the move.
- SMS/Email: Provides all job details.
- Notifies the driver of confirmed booking via:some text
- Details Provided:some text
- Pickup Information: Address, contact person, special instructions.
- Delivery Information: Address, contact person.
- Schedule: Date and time commitments.
- Payment Confirmation: Assures the driver that payment is secured.
- Driver Actions:some text
- Acknowledges receipt.
- Confirms readiness to proceed.
- AI Applications:some text
- Scheduling Module: Updates driver's calendar.
- Route Planning: Begins initial route optimization.
12. Pre-Transport Coordination
- AI Monitors:some text
- Driver's Location: Real-time GPS tracking.
- Traffic Conditions: Adjusts route as needed.
- Weather Forecasts: Plans for any potential disruptions.
- Communication with Customer:some text
- Provides:some text
- Driver's ETA: Estimated time of arrival for pickup.
- Driver's Details: Name, vehicle description, contact (if necessary).
- Real-Time Tracking Link: Allows the customer to monitor progress.
- Provides:some text
- AI Applications:some text
- Dynamic Routing Algorithms: Optimize for efficiency.
- Predictive Analytics: Anticipate and mitigate delays.
13. Pickup Execution
- Driver Arrives at Pickup Location:some text
- Notifies AI upon arrival.
- AI Actions:some text
- Sends an arrival notification to the customer.
- Facilitates any necessary communication between driver and customer.
- Loading Process:some text
- Driver may use AI assistance to document the load:some text
- Photographs: Takes images of the cargo before loading.
- Condition Report: Notes any pre-existing damage.
- Driver may use AI assistance to document the load:some text
- AI Applications:some text
- Image Storage and Analysis: Stores photos for future reference.
- Documentation Management: Keeps records organized.
14. Transport to Delivery Location
- In Transit:some text
- Driver Actions:some text
- Follows AI-provided route.
- Adheres to safe driving practices.
- AI Monitoring:some text
- Continuously tracks vehicle location.
- Monitors for any deviations or delays.
- Driver Actions:some text
- Communication with Customer:some text
- Provides updated ETAs.
- Alerts if any significant changes occur.
- AI Applications:some text
- Anomaly Detection: Identifies unexpected stops or route changes.
- Communication Automation: Sends timely updates.
15. Delivery Execution
- Driver Arrives at Delivery Location:some text
- Notifies AI of arrival.
- AI Actions:some text
- Sends notification to the recipient.
- Facilitates communication if assistance is needed.
- Unloading Process:some text
- Driver unloads the cargo carefully.
- May document the condition of the cargo upon delivery:some text
- Photographs: Takes images after unloading.
- Delivery Confirmation: Obtains recipient's acknowledgment.
- AI Applications:some text
- Proof of Delivery Management: Collects and stores confirmation data.
- Image Analysis: Verifies cargo condition.
16. Post-Delivery Confirmation
- AI Contacts Customer:some text
- Requests confirmation that delivery was successful and satisfactory.
- Asks for any immediate feedback.
- Customer Actions:some text
- Confirms receipt and condition of the cargo.
- Reports any issues if present.
- AI Applications:some text
- Customer Satisfaction Analysis: Records feedback.
- Issue Escalation Protocols: Initiates dispute resolution if needed.
17. Payment Release to Driver/Transport Company
- AI Actions:some text
- Confirms all contractual obligations are met.
- Releases funds from the escrow account to the driver's or transport company's bank account.
- Third-Party Integrations:some text
- Banking APIs: Facilitates secure fund transfer.
- Communication:some text
- Notifies driver and transport company of payment release.
- Sends transaction receipts to all parties.
18. Feedback and Ratings
- AI Requests Feedback:some text
- Sends a survey or rating request to the customer.
- Asks for ratings on:some text
- Driver Performance
- Service Quality
- Overall Experience
- Customer Actions:some text
- Provides ratings and comments.
- AI Applications:some text
- Reputation Management: Updates driver and service profiles.
- Data Analytics: Uses feedback for service improvements.
19. Dispute Resolution (If Necessary)
- Issue Detection:some text
- If the customer reports damage or unsatisfactory service.
- AI Actions:some text
- Gathers all relevant data:some text
- Before and After Photos
- Route and Timing Logs
- Driver's Notes
- Gathers all relevant data:some text
- Analysis:some text
- Uses Machine Learning Models to assess the legitimacy of the claim.
- Determines if the issue can be resolved automatically.
- Resolution:some text
- If Resolvable by AI:some text
- Proposes a solution (e.g., partial refund, future discount).
- Communicates with both parties to implement the solution.
- If Not Resolvable:some text
- Escalates to a human dispute resolution manager.
- Provides all compiled data for review.
- If Resolvable by AI:some text
- Third-Party Integrations:some text
- Insurance Claims APIs: Initiates a claim if insurance was purchased.
20. Post-Service Engagement
- AI Actions:some text
- Updates customer's profile with the transaction history.
- May offer:some text
- Loyalty Rewards: Discounts on future services.
- Referral Programs: Incentives for recommending the service.
- Communication:some text
- Sends personalized messages thanking the customer.
- Shares any promotional offers.
21. Driver and Vehicle Data Updates
- AI Updates Records:some text
- Logs the completed delivery in the driver's profile.
- Updates vehicle usage and maintenance schedules.
- Compliance Monitoring:some text
- Checks for upcoming expirations of:some text
- Driver's License
- Vehicle Inspection Certificates
- Insurance Policies
- Checks for upcoming expirations of:some text
- Communication with Driver/Transport Company:some text
- Sends reminders for renewals.
- Provides links or guidance to complete necessary updates.
- AI Applications:some text
- Automated Compliance Module: Ensures all legal requirements are met.
- Scheduling Assistant: Helps plan for renewals without disrupting service availability.
22. Continuous Improvement and Learning
- AI Learning Processes:some text
- Analyzes transaction data to improve:some text
- Routing Algorithms: Learns from traffic patterns.
- Pricing Models: Adjusts for market demand and cost factors.
- Service Quality Metrics: Identifies areas for enhancement.
- Analyzes transaction data to improve:some text
- Data Management:some text
- Stores data securely with appropriate encryption.
- Ensures compliance with data protection regulations like GDPR.
23. Revenue Management
- AI Actions:some text
- Calculates service fees:some text
- Subscription Fees: Monthly charges for transport companies.
- Transaction Commissions: Percentage from completed orders.
- Updates accounting records.
- Calculates service fees:some text
- Communication with Transport Companies:some text
- Sends invoices for subscription renewals.
- Provides detailed statements of transactions and fees.
- Third-Party Integrations:some text
- Accounting Software (e.g., QuickBooks, Xero): Syncs financial data.
24. Customer Retention and Marketing
- AI Strategies:some text
- Identifies patterns for customer retention.
- Plans targeted marketing campaigns.
- Communication:some text
- Sends personalized offers based on customer preferences and history.
- Notifies about new services or features.
- AI Applications:some text
- Predictive Marketing Models: Anticipates customer needs.
- Segmentation Analysis: Groups customers for tailored communication.
25. Compliance and Regulatory Updates
- AI Monitoring:some text
- Keeps abreast of changes in transport regulations.
- Updates policies and procedures accordingly.
- Communication:some text
- Informs drivers and transport companies of regulatory changes.
- Provides guidance on compliance requirements.
- AI Applications:some text
- Regulatory Compliance Module: Automates updates to ensure adherence to laws.
Summary
Throughout this comprehensive journey, the AI-driven system manages every micro-level detail:
- Customer Interaction: Provides a seamless, multi-channel communication experience.
- Load Assessment: Uses advanced AI to accurately assess transport needs.
- Driver Coordination: Ensures safe and efficient communication with drivers.
- Payment Processing: Handles financial transactions securely and transparently.
- Delivery Management: Monitors and updates all parties for timely delivery.
- Post-Service Processes: Facilitates feedback, dispute resolution, and continuous improvement.
- Compliance and Data Security: Maintains strict adherence to legal and ethical standards.
Third-Party Applications and Integrations:
- Payment Gateways: Secure financial transactions.
- GPS and Mapping Services: Real-time tracking and route optimization.
- Weather and Traffic APIs: Enhance predictive analytics.
- Banking APIs: Facilitate fund transfers.
- Insurance APIs: Manage coverage and claims.
- Compliance Services: Verify licenses and certifications.
- Accounting Software: Streamline financial management.
By meticulously detailing each communication and action, this journey illustrates how AI handles the full lifecycle of transport management, ensuring efficiency, safety, and customer satisfaction at every step.